UPDATE

Well ive just fixed it :D

Was a codec problem, i could'nt find me first disc for COD2, so i tried the 6.5's with oblivion instead, was the same, tried the chuck patch, was the same, so i thought it seemed to be doing it when the music changed as well, i.e when the rats bust out of the wall the music picks up and it pauses there to, and it also done it when the tutorial boxes came up to, as they make a sound as well, so i removed my community codec pack, my quicktime, and this other voideo codec, and volia, running sweet as again, pause has vanished, so im going back to the 6.8's, and im going to install my codecs again one by one, and test Oblvion each time so i can find out which one is messing it up. :D

Could be a codec problem for you to BloodWolf, if you have any others on there, but its running sweet as a nut again now for me seen as ive removed some codecs that i put on. :)
